What is the Spring-Fall Weekend Personal Equipment List?
The Spring-Fall Weekend Personal Equipment List is a vital tool for scouts preparing for weekend camping trips during transitional seasons. It serves as a personal equipment checklist designed specifically for spring and fall conditions, ensuring that scouts are well-equipped for varying weather. The list aids in the systematic organization of essential items, making it a necessary resource for anyone involved in scouting.

Key Features of the Spring-Fall Weekend Personal Equipment List
The Spring-Fall Weekend Personal Equipment List includes several critical sections essential for any camping trip. Users will find categories such as:
-
Footwear
-
Clothing
-
Outerwear
-
Sleep gear
-
Personal hygiene items
-
Backpack equipment
-
Miscellaneous items
Each section comprises blank fields and checkboxes, allowing users to complete the list according to their needs. Moreover, optional items can be added for specific camping scenarios, making the form adaptable for various outdoor conditions.
